Output ff073e003d777982c016f523decaac4ac53edc91767c60c0b059619200905932:6

value
11656590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6e20cab94b5674bfa662dd5b13699f7a96a5948 OP_EQUALVERIFY OP_CHECKSIG
address
1N3oDKH5vyR3XoE6m4sbBKC7EyHd5aZANS
transaction
ff073e003d777982c016f523decaac4ac53edc91767c60c0b059619200905932
spent
true